When is the best time to visit Ukraine from Brazil?
Understanding Ukraine's distinct four seasons is vital for planning. From snowy winters to warm summers, each period offers different flight prices and unique cultural experiences for Brazilian travelers.
Winter brings cold temperatures and beautiful snow-covered landscapes. It is the perfect time for Christmas markets, traditional carols, and enjoying hearty Ukrainian cuisine in cozy settings.
Spring is a time of rebirth. As the snow melts, parks turn green and cherry blossoms bloom, making it a great time for sightseeing.
Summer is the peak tourist season. Enjoy long sunny days, outdoor music festivals, and the cooling breeze of the Black Sea coast.
Autumn is the shoulder season with mild weather and fewer crowds. It is the best time for wine tasting and forest hikes.

Ukrainian culture is deeply rooted in hospitality and tradition. When entering someone's home, it is customary to remove your shoes at the door; hosts usually provide slippers. If invited for dinner, bringing a small gift like flowers or sweets is appreciated, but ensure you bring an odd number of flowers, as even numbers are for funerals. Ukrainians value directness and sincerity in conversation. While people may seem reserved initially, they are often very warm once a connection is made. Learning a few basic phrases in Ukrainian, such as 'Dyakuyu' for thank you, goes a long way in showing respect. Respecting religious sites is also important; women should consider covering their heads when entering Orthodox churches, and men should remove hats. Understanding these small nuances helps you connect more deeply with the local population during your stay.
Travelers should stay informed about the current safety situation in Ukraine by monitoring international news and government advisories. In urban centers like Kyiv or Lviv, common sense is your best tool. Be aware of your surroundings in crowded areas where pickpockets might operate, similar to major cities in Brazil. Avoid unlicensed taxis and always agree on a price beforehand or use reputable ride-sharing apps to ensure a fair rate. Be cautious of overly friendly strangers offering unsolicited help or invitations to specific bars, which could lead to inflated bills. Keep your valuables in a secure place and avoid displaying large amounts of cash. It is also beneficial to register with your embassy upon arrival. By staying alert and following local advice, you can navigate the country more securely and focus on the unique cultural experiences Ukraine offers.
Ukrainian cuisine is hearty and diverse, focusing on fresh, local ingredients. You must try Borscht, a beetroot-based soup often served with sour cream and garlic bread called pampushky. Varenyky, which are dumplings filled with potatoes, cheese, or meat, are another staple. For a local tip, seek out 'Stolova' style cafeterias for authentic, affordable meals that locals frequent. Don't be a tourist by only eating at international chains; instead, explore local markets like Besarabsky in Kyiv to taste fresh cheeses and honey. To experience the country like a local, try Salo (cured pork fat) with rye bread and green onions. For a great photo and a unique memory, visit a traditional coffee house in Lviv's old town.
